I have a 1998 Mustang Saleen. I am looking into buying a supercharger kit for the car. My main focus was on the Vortech v-2 system. This kit produces 75 more horsepower and 100 trq. Will my car handle this power. How strong are the pistons in my car? Thie kit is rated at 7-9 lbs.

with a good tune, your car should do just fine!! Pistons aren't too strong in those motors, but that power level shouldn't hurt at all, as long as it is dyno tuned

your car should be able to handle the extra load. most people have had very good success with running low psi like that and getting decent numbers and still long life of their engine. also, its almost like doing the pi head swap, get about 50-60 more hp and never any problems with the motor, so you should be fine
